Violent domestic abuser wanted on prison recall arrested after two weeks on the run

byDaniel Jae Webb
21 July 2022 | 9.49am
Violent domestic abuser wanted on prison recall arrested after two weeks on the run
Share on FacebookPost on XSend via WhatsApp

A violent domestic abuser spent two weeks on the run before being arrested by police.

Wiltshire Police issued an appeal for help from the public to locate 46-year-old David Dent, from Chippenham, on 11 July.

The force yesterday (Wednesday, 20 July), confirmed he has been arrested in Bristol and returned to prison.

In 2004, he stabbed his pregnant girlfriend in the stomach. He was jailed for eight years.

Last year he repeatedly smacked his ex-girlfriend – a different woman to the previous victim – over the head with a crowbar outside Lackham College. He was jailed for two years and eleven months.

In a statement, Wiltshire Police said: “Thank you to everyone who has shared our appeals regarding wanted man David Dent.

“We are pleased to confirm that he has now been located in the Bristol area.

“He has been arrested and recalled to prison.”
